| Domain | Definition |
Health | A large group of aerobic bacteria which show up as pink (negative) when treated by the gram-staining method. (references) |

| Thumbnail | Description & Credit | Burkholderia pseudomallei is a Gram-negative aerobic bacteria, and is the causative agent of melioidosis. The organism's colonial morphology changes somewhat as the incubation is extended. Credit: CDC. | |
